Story

We all completed the Challenge as planned and Thanks to your generosity also were Cup Winners for the team raising most for Railway Children

We left Crewe as planned at 19.30 on Thursday. Snowdon was completed in the dark between 22.45 on Thursday and 3.30 on Friday. After an hour's sleep on route to Scafell Pike we climbed the second peak between 9.50 and 16.30 on Friday. A problem with the train meant a 2 hour wait in Ravenglass before setting off for Ben Nevis. We grabbed about 4 hours sleep overnight before starting the last climb at 6.00 on Saturday and finishing by 12.00. A long journey home (10 -11 hours)  followed and a good night's sleep on Saturday.

The weather wasn't too kind with mist and drizzle on all three summits but it didn't dampen a wonderful experience for us all.
